Bouwfonds Marignan sells 2 office projects for EUR 168m

Bouwfonds Marignan Immobilier has announced the sale of two office development projects in France for a total of EUR 168 mln. The French development arm of Dutch group Rabo Real Estate has sold Le Skalen in Châtillon, Hauts-de-Seine, to a fund managed by Area Property Partners for a price of EUR 133 mln. It also anticipated the sale of the B. Initial office project in the Parisian suburb of Montreuil to the Notapierre SCPI investment vehicle, managed by B&C Asset Management, for EUR 55 mln.

Le Skalen, located in the vicinity of the Châtillon-Montrouge metro station, offers nearly 25,000 m2 of office space and 394 underground parking spaces. Delivery of the High-Quality Environmental (HQE) building is planned for June 2013.

The HQE-certified B. Initial project will offer nearly 12,000 m2 of office accommodation and 135 parking spaces on completion in early 2013. It is being developed in partnership with Spie Batignolles Immobilier and was designed by architects Hubert Godet.

Bouwfonds Marignan Immobilier said it expects to sign the sales agreement by the end of July. Construction is planned to start in September this year.
